Takehisa Suzuki is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Takehisa Suzuki has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 624 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Surgery and 3 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Takehisa Suzuki’s work include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(3 papers), Marine Toxins and Detection Methods (2 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(2 papers). Takehisa Suzuki is often cited by papers focused on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(3 papers), Marine Toxins and Detection Methods (2 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(2 papers). Takehisa Suzuki collaborates with scholars based in Japan and India. Takehisa Suzuki's co-authors include Hideo Iba, Kazumasa Miki, Naohisa Yahagi, Yasuhito Shimizu and Toshio Nishikawa and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and Journal of Virology.
